sailingdutchy Posted February 7, 2018 #426 Share Posted February 7, 2018 You probably already know this; it's a pic of "The Binnenhof" or "Inner Court", a complex of buildings in the city center of The Hague, next to the Hofvijver lake. It houses the meeting place of both houses of the States General of the Netherlands (the legislature of the Netherlands), as well as the Ministry of General Affairs and the office of the Prime Minister. Built primarily in the 13th century, the Gothic castle originally functioned as residence of the counts of Holland and became the political center of the Dutch Republic in 1584. It is counted among the Top 100 Dutch heritage sites. The Binnenhof is the oldest House of Parliament in the world still in use. Thank you for refreshing the history Copper .
